The NORTON 69957344982 is a coated abrasive belt engineered for aggressive material removal in demanding grinding and finishing applications. Part of the R980P series, it features a ceramic alumina abrasive grain on a heavy-duty Y-weight polyester backing, delivering the rigidity and heat resistance required for high-pressure belt grinding. The closed coat density maximizes abrasive coverage across the belt surface, making it well suited for fast stock removal on ferrous metals and hard alloys. At 50 grit coarse grade, this belt cuts aggressively and handles both wet and dry operation, giving technicians flexibility across different workstation setups.
This belt measures 3/4 inches wide by 20-1/2 inches long and is sized for portable belt sanders and small stationary grinding machines commonly used in metal fabrication shops, weld dressing operations, and industrial maintenance environments. The ceramic alumina grain self-sharpens under pressure, extending belt life compared to conventional aluminum oxide options. Wet or dry compatibility makes it adaptable for coolant-assisted grinding where heat control is critical. This SKU ships as a single belt with a minimum order quantity of 200 units.
Designed as a replacement or production-supply abrasive belt for portable and stationary belt sanders and grinders that accept a 3/4 inch by 20-1/2 inch belt format.
Installation and replacement should be performed by a qualified operator following the equipment manufacturer's belt-tensioning and tracking procedures. Power down and lockout the machine before changing the belt. Verify belt orientation with the arrow marked on the inner surface to ensure the splice runs in the correct direction of travel. Wear appropriate PPE including eye protection and gloves during belt changes and operation.
